2. Technical Superiority
- 92-95% energy efficiency vs. 75-80% in brushed motors, cutting operational costs by $18.50 per motor annually
- IP68-rated sealing withstands particulate-heavy environments in agriculture and manufacturing
- ±0.01° torque accuracy for surgical robotics and CNC machining precision
3. Maintenance Elimination
- 100,000+ hour lifespan without brush replacement, reducing downtime by 78% in 24/7 operations
- Electronic commutation eliminates carbon dust contamination in medical/pharma applications

IV. 4-Step Profit Optimization Framework
- Technical Specification Alignment
- Match torque-speed curves to application requirements using ANSYS thermal reports
- Standardize voltage ratings across facilities (e.g., 48V for solar fleets)
- Tiered Volume Negotiation
- Lock annual quotas at 10k+ units for maximum discount eligibility
- Negotiate consignment stocking at regional hubs (e.g., LA/Long Beach)
- Lifecycle Value Engineering
- Implement predictive maintenance via IoT-enabled controllers
- Recycle neodymium magnets under circular economy programs
- Compliance Future-Proofing
- Ensure adherence to 2025 EU Ecodesign Regulation (Lot 30)
- Verify California SB 343 e-waste compliance for US exports
